SummaryWe are seeking an experienced Electrical Contracts Manager to oversee and manage electrical contracts from inception to completion. You will be responsible for programming works, valuing variations, and ensuring the smooth delivery of projects.

You must be capable of running three simultaneous projects with values ranging between £1-10 million. Due to the location, you must be a driver with a UK driving license. The hours will be 8am - 5.30pm Monday to Thursday and 8am - 4:30 pm on a Friday.

Key Responsibilities

  • Oversee the full lifecycle of electrical contracts, ensuring timely and cost-effective completion.
  • Manage and coordinate project programming and scheduling.
  • Assess and value contract variations, ensuring accurate financial control.
  • Liaise with clients, suppliers, and subcontractors to ensure smooth project delivery.
  • Conduct regular site visits to monitor progress and compliance with project requirements.
  • Ensure projects adhere to health and safety regulations and industry standards.
  • Provide leadership and direction to project teams, ensuring high performance and efficiency.

Requirements

  • Proven experience in managing electrical contracts of similar value and scale.
  • Strong knowledge of electrical installation processes and regulations.
  • 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ously.
  • Strong commercial awareness, with experience in valuations and cost control.
  • Excellent communication and leadership skills.
  • Proficiency in relevant project management software and tools.
  • Full UK driving license.

Remuneration & Benefits

  • Competitive salary
  • 25 days annual leave plus bank holidays
  • Free parking on site
  • Company pension and private health care (after 6 months)
  • Car allowance of £5,000 per annum.
  • Company laptop & mobile phone provided.
